Hong Kong
Hong Kong's total area of 2755.03 square kilometers, but only about 1104 square kilometers is the land area.And Hong Kong 's total population of 7.0086 million, including about 21 million floating population, urban population density on average of up to 21,000 people per square kilometer, is the world's most densely populated cities.The off
icial languages in Hong Kong are "two languages and three dialects", written on the use of Traditional Chinese and English, spoken on the use of Cantonese, Putonghua and English.

Hong Kong is a special administrative region, it has its own completely independent of the management system, self-distribution and circulation of its own currency of Hong Kong; a self-determined immigration policy. As of the end of 2007, the world's 170 countries and territories citizens or residents to enter Hong Kong visa-free.

Hong Kong has a highly developed and sophisticated transport network. The main components of public transport including railways, buses, mini-buses, taxis, and ferries. Among them, the railway is the most important public transport in Hong Kong, followed by the franchised bus. There is about 276 vehicle in per kilometer of road in Hong Kong, so it is so close-packed.
In other way, located at Chek Lap Kok Hong Kong International Airport is the world's fifth busiest international passenger airport, is between Europe and the United States and Asia and Oceania flight transfer point.
Area: It consists of Hong Kong Island (about 81 square kilometers), the Kowloon Peninsula (about 47 square kilometers), the New Territories hinterland and 262 small islands (Islands) (a total of 976 square kilometers), with a total area of 1104 square kilometers.
